With a distance of just twelve miles from Fort William, Hotel Roy Bridge is set in a picturesque location, deep in the renowned Scottish Highlands. Offering a range of accommodation, this hotel provides private rooms with tea and coffee making facilities, TVs and private bathrooms. Guests at this hotel will be able to use the ample free parking, ideal for outdoors enthusiasts. There is also a bar that hosts live music and guests can access free Wi-Fi. The accommodation features a restaurant and bar, which serves meals throughout the day. Breakfast is also available at this hotel. Hotel Roy Bridge is ideally located for guests wanting to explore the great outdoors in the Highlands. It is just twelve miles from Fort William and makes a good base for hikes up Ben Nevis.

Facilities & Amenities
Most guests highlight the hotel's strong dog-friendly policy as a significant advantage, extending to both the unique lodges and the main bar area, allowing pets to accompany their owners throughout their stay. The property offers ample parking, which is a convenient feature for those traveling by car. While some guests appreciate the availability of free Wi-Fi and in-room tea and coffee facilities, others report inconsistent Wi-Fi signal, particularly in the more remote cabins. The general decor throughout the property is frequently described as dated or old-fashioned, with some areas, especially the bar, lacking a vibrant atmosphere. Guests staying in lodges or cabins often enjoy the outdoor balcony spaces, providing a pleasant spot to relax.
Cleanliness & Room Comfort
Guest feedback on cleanliness is varied; while many describe their rooms and lodges as very clean and well-maintained, some reviews report issues with dirtiness or a general lack of tidiness. Room comfort also receives mixed reviews, with some guests finding the beds comfortable and rooms adequately spacious, while others describe beds as uncomfortable, lumpy, or worn out. Bathrooms and showers are generally functional, though some guests noted small or basic facilities, and occasional issues with hot water availability. Noise levels can be a significant concern, particularly from thin walls between rooms or from the gravel car park, impacting sleep quality for some. In-room heating is sometimes inconsistent, with reports of rooms being cold, and some lodges require guests to pay for electricity.
Dining & Food Quality
The hotel's bar serves as the primary dining area, with no separate restaurant space, which some guests found to lack atmosphere. Food quality receives highly mixed reviews; while some guests praise specific dishes like the steak pie and chips as delicious and generous, many others express disappointment, describing meals as overpriced, tasting like frozen or pre-made items, or being of low standard. There are also recurring complaints about being charged extra for condiments. Breakfast options are frequently criticized for being basic, uninspiring, and not always included in the room rate, with some guests reporting issues like mouldy bread or limited choices, and early morning service times that may not suit all travelers.
Location & Accessibility
The hotel's location is generally considered convenient for exploring the Scottish Highlands, being a short drive from Fort William and serving as a practical base for activities like hiking Ben Nevis. Many guests appreciate the ample parking available on-site, which adds to the convenience for those traveling by car. However, some guests noted that the hotel is not directly in Fort William, requiring additional travel time to reach the town. While some rooms and lodges offer pleasant views of the river, others are situated very close to the main road, leading to complaints about road noise impacting the tranquility of the stay for some guests.
Staff & Service
Feedback on staff and service is notably polarized. Many guests commend the friendly staff for being helpful, welcoming, and accommodating, particularly regarding late arrivals or specific requests. They appreciate the personal touch and local knowledge provided by some team members. Conversely, a significant number of reviews describe staff as rude, unprofessional, unhelpful, or abrupt, leading to negative interactions, especially during check-in or when issues arose with bookings or room allocations. Some guests felt a lack of general customer service or a disinterest from staff, with instances of being left waiting or experiencing confrontational attitudes.
Additional Information
A prominent feature is the hotel's strong dog-friendly policy, welcoming pets in both rooms and the bar area, which is a significant draw for many travelers. Guests should be aware of certain room rules, such as restrictions on preparing hot food in bedrooms. The check-in process can be unconventional, with some guests reporting initial difficulties like locked doors or staff being unavailable, and a payment policy that sometimes requires upfront payment. There are also mentions of an unusual public toilet policy for non-guests, which has caused confusion. Some lodges require guests to pay for electricity via electricity meters, which can be an unexpected cost. The overall value for money is a recurring point of contention, with many guests feeling the cost does not align with the basic amenities and service provided.
